TV legend Noel Edmonds has joined I'm a Celebrity... Get Me Out of Here! as a late entrant of the 2018 series, ITV has confirmed after weeks of rumours.

The former Deal or No Deal host will join the rest of the campmates later this week, including the likes of Nick Knowles, John Barrowman and Anne Hegerty.

Noel - who turns 70 next month - has promised that he will never appear on TV ever again if he is crowned King of the Jungle.

“I am going to win because I promise the British public if they vote for me, I will retire from television and I will never appear again," he said.

"There’s a deal that I am striking with the great British public who have supported me over the years - they make me ‘King of the Jungle’ and I will retire and never appear again!”

Noel added that it was host Declan Donnelly who convinced him to sign up, saying: “It actually started as I was filming with Dec earlier in the year and he said ‘Ah you should do the Jungle’. Our 15-year-old son, Harrison, was there at the time and he said ‘it will be brilliant; you have got to do the Jungle’.”

“He put me under considerable pressure. The reason why I’m going to have this amazing experience is down to Harrison. I just love the idea that I’m going to live out in the natural environment. I’m looking forward to learning more about myself and meeting people I would never normally ever spend time with.”

Noel is best known for hosting the hugely popular 1990s TV series Noel's House Party, and later Deal or No Deal, as well as his various TV and radio work in the 1960s and 70s.
